AWS::MediaLive::Channel PipelineLockingSettings

Pipeline Locking Settings

Syntax

To declare this entity in your Amazon CloudFormation template, use the following syntax:

JSON

{ "CustomEpoch" : String, "PipelineLockingMethod" : String }

YAML

CustomEpoch: String PipelineLockingMethod: String

Properties

CustomEpoch

Optional. Only applies to CMAF Ingest Output Group and MediaPackage V2 Output Group Only. Enter a value here to use a custom epoch, instead of the standard epoch (which started at 1970-01-01T00:00:00 UTC). Specify the start time of the custom epoch, in YYYY-MM-DDTHH:MM:SS in UTC. The time must be 2000-01-01T00:00:00 or later. Always set the MM:SS portion to 00:00.

Required: No

Type: String

Update requires: No interruption

PipelineLockingMethod

The method to use to lock the video frames in the pipelines. sourceTimecode (default): Use the timecode in the source. videoAlignment: Lock frames that the encoder identifies as having matching content. If videoAlignment is selected, existing timecodes will not be used for any locking decisions.

Required: No

Type: String

Update requires: No interruption
